Job Description:
As a Systems Support Technician, you will be responsible for performing field service, installation, commissioning, and support for all equipment built or supplied by Westfalia Technologies.
Your expertise will ensure that our customers receive exceptional service and that our control systems operate seamlessly.
Responsibilities:
PLC Code Documentation:
Maintain accurate documentation of PLC code for control systems.
Troubleshooting and Debugging:
Identify and resolve issues with PLC-based control systems at customer sites, ensuring optimal performance.
Control Systems Testing:
Conduct thorough testing of control systems to validate their functionality and reliability.
Control Systems Wiring:
Perform wiring tasks for control systems, ensuring proper connections and adherence to safety standards.
Control Systems Installation/Commissioning:
Install and commission control systems, ensuring they are operational and meeting customer requirements.
On-Call Support:
Participate in an on-call rotation to provide emergency phone support to customers.
Part and Service Support:
Assist in sales and support for spare parts related to S/RMs, conveyors, palletizers, and robots.
Accept, process, and follow up on parts orders.
Customer Service:
Deliver world-class customer service by providing preventative ma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air support to customers both on-site and in-house.
Collaboration:
Interface with Sales and Engineering teams to meet customer requirements and facilitate effective communication.
Documentation and Reporting:
Submit all necessary paperwork in a timely and professional manner.
Teamwork:
Foster a sense of teamwork within the Service Department and maintain professional relationships with internal and external customers.
Production Shop Support:
Assist in the Production Shop with assigned tasks during periods when no service work is available.
Qualifications:
Travel:
Willingness to travel approximately 70% of the time.
Communication Skills:
Excellent verbal and written communication skills to effectively interact with customers and internal teams.
Software Proficiency:
Proficient with Microsoft Office (Outlook, Excel, Word) and Rockwell programming software and hardware, such as Logix500, Logix5000, PanelView, and Factory Talk View (HMI).
Technical Competence:
Solid understanding of DeviceNet and Industrial Ethernet.
Familiarity with mechanical hardware used in pallet, case, bottle, and bag handling systems, as well as packaging or material handling equipment.
Knowledge of industrial electrical components and control system requirements in a washdown environment.
Sensor Expertise:
Familiarity with industrial sensors, including photoeyes and proximity switches, and understanding of the NEC.
Programming Skills:
Proficiency in industrial control system design, programming, and troubleshooting, particularly with Allen-Bradley PLC, HMI, and VFD hardware, and Siemens TIA Portal.
Multitasking Ability:
Strong multitasking skills with the flexibility to adjust priorities as needed.
Safety Consciousness:
A strong commitment to safety in all aspects of the job.
Education/
Experience:
Education:
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ering (BSEE) or equivalent experience.
Experience:
Minimum of 1-4 years of relevant experience, including electro/mechanical repair and troubleshooting.
Physical Requirements:
Stationary Position:
Must be able to remain in a stationary position for50% of the time.
Vertical Ladder:
Must be able to ascend and descend fixed vertical ladders, up to 125' high, for 10% of the time.
Physical Mobility:
Regular stooping, kneeling, crouching, and crawling in and around machinery for inspections and maintenance.
Communication:
Frequent clear and active communication with others during manual operation of machines.
Visual Assessment:
Ability to visually assess machinery in dark environments.
Temperature Range:
Work environment temperatures range from -40F to 110F.
Travel:
Must be fit for air travel and legally able to rent and drive a rental vehicle.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
